From: Flash floods mitigation and assessment of groundwater possibilities using remote sensing and GIS applications: Sharm El Sheikh, South Sinai, Egypt

Fig. 4

Contour map of the maximum precipitation in 1 day for 7 meteorological stations (1976-2010), clarify that Sharm El Sheikh has the highest record (59 mm) in comparison with other stations. The rainfall data have been obtained from the following meteorological stations (1 Taba, 2 Abu Rudis, 3 El Tor, 4 Sharm El Sheikh, 5 Saint Kathrin, 6 Taba, and 7 Nekhel
